We’ll learn:
- Grace Over Grind: Morgan emphasizes the importance of giving yourself grace in motherhood, especially when balancing it with entrepreneurship.
- Support Systems Matter: Having her grandmother nearby has been a game-changer for Morgan, giving her peace of mind and space to grow her business.
- Motherhood Changes Everything — Including Your Goals: Becoming a mom reshaped Morgan’s vision for her business. What once was a dream of leading a large team became a desire for a smaller, more intentional operation, aligned with her new priorities.
- Healing Through Motherhood: Morgan shares how becoming a mom has been unexpectedly healing, particularly in mending generational wounds.
- Intentional Self-Care and Grounding Practices: To manage overwhelm, Morgan finds stillness in grounding herself—literally—by standing barefoot in the grass and soaking in the sun.
